Sistemas combinacionales

Estudio primero de ing. Informática y me gustaría que me aclarasen algunas dudas que tengo sobre esta materia:
-Sumadores, anticipación del acarreo por acarreo generado o propagado: en la generación del acarreo se genera acarreo solo cuando ambos bits de entrada son 1, ¿cómo sabe que el acarreo de entrada no es uno, en cuyo caso con un solo uno ya tendría que generar acarreo? Y en propagación, que se propaga cuando al menos uno de los bits de entrada sea uno, no tienen por que coincidir el acarreo de entrada y el de salida, si lo propagas saldrá todo mal, ¿no?!
-Restadores: que significa en estos el acarreo de entrada y el de salida, ¿el signo o algo así? Y la salida como la dan, ¿normal o como complemento a dos?
-¿Qué es un glitche? (Algo sobre los retrasos en los biestables)
-En un circuito de desplazamiento (registros) inhib (0 0) ¿No desplaza? Y q hace load (1 1)?
-¿Salidas triestado?! No se ni de que van ni si tiene que ver con botánica o informática !? |:-((
-Automatas de moore, ¿q no dependen de la entrada?! Demonios creo q voy a suspender (si mis profesores se dedicaran a resolver dudas y no a dictar del librito en clase lo mismo me pasaba por ahi y no tenia luego q estar tan jodido)
1

1 respuesta

Respuesta
1
Voy a intentar soulcionarte todas tus dudas, aunque no pueda hacerte diagramas (que ayudan mucho) porque sé el infierno que es tener profesores que sólo recitan apuntes como papagayos.
1° Sumadores, anticipación del acarreo:
Se genera el acarreo cuando ambos bits de entrada son 1 porque en ese caso se sabe seguro que el carry out va a ser 1 sea cual sea el carry in(proviniente del semisumador anterior), y por tanto se puede ya ir "anticipando" el acarreo. En caso de que las entradas sean 1 0 no se sabe lo que va a salir el acarreo, y por tanto no se gana tiempo para el siguiente bit en la anticipación. Esto no nos preocupa, porque en los bits que lo hayamos generado ganamos tiempo con la anticipación.
Con la propagación, si sólo uno de los dos bits de entrada es uno (1,0) y (0,1) el carry de entrada coincide siempre con el de salida, compruébalo.
-Restadores: El acarreo de entrada y de salida es como la que te llevas cuando haces las restas a mano, si restas 5 menos 7 te quedan 8 y te llevas una, que se lo sumas al sustraendo siguiente. Pues igual pasa en combinacional, lo que te llevas es un 1 que tienes que restar en el bit siguiente. La salida sale como esté la entrada, eso es lo que mola del complemento a 2.
- No se que es un glitche, soooorryyyyy
-Desplazadores: Si, la función 00 de las variables de control no hace nada. Y la función load (11) carga el número que nos entra desde fuera (carga bit a bit las entradas del registro).
-Salida triestado: Tienen 3 posibles estados 1, 0 y deshabilitado o en alta impedancia. Esto vale para que cuando tengas varias salidas de estas conectadas a un bus, las que estén deshabilitadas no cambian el valor de lo que vaya por el bus. En estos casos suele habilitarse sólo una de las salidas de las que están conectadas al bus.
-Moore: En los autómatas de More, la salida no depende de la entrada actual, sólo del estado. En realidad si depende de la entrada, pero de la entrada de pulsos anteriores, y esto se ve reflejado en el estado. Así que para saber la salida en cada momento de una Máquina de Moore, sólo tienes que ver el estado actual (p. Ej. Estado 0 salida 1, estado 2 salida 0, etc...). Como podrás ver, estar en un estado o en otro depende de las entradas en pulsos anteriores, y por tanto la salida sólo depende de la secuencia de entradas anteriores, no de la entrada en éste pulso. Por este motivo se dice que la Moore va un pulso de reloj atrasada con respecto a la Mealy.
Espero que te sirva de ayuda, si necesitas alguna aclaración no dudes en volver a consultarme ;-),
Kortatu

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as